Dawid Szczybylo is completing an apprenticeship as a machine and plant operator in our company. In addition to operating and inspecting our production facilities, this job also includes identifying potential malfunctions and any necessary maintenance work, including the replacement of wear parts. Providing auxiliary or raw materials for the production of our wire mesh is also part of the daily work in this area.

The basic requirements for training as a machine and plant operator are not only good observation skills, technical understanding and manual dexterity, but also the enjoyment of working on and with machines as well as great care, which must always be demonstrated, are part of the job profile.
